Water pressure refers to the pressure of water in a system. In a home it will be 30-50 psi typically and this is governed by the municipal pressure or by a well tank.
House water pressure should be around 50-60 psi.
No and yes. No, you won't get more water pressure. To do that you'll need to find out why the water pressure is low. Perhaps flow restriction, perhaps a poorly adjusted water pressure regulator, perhaps low pressure from the well/city water. But an additional water heater will certainly give you more hot water. It would be like putting in a LARGER water heater. In most cities the water pressure required is about 20 PSI. Small city's do not add pressure pumps to their system but use a gravity supply. That is why most places there is a pressure problem either build their water tanks taller or erect them on a hill.

An angle stop is not intended to control water pressure for most applications. That being said, however, you can control the pressure with an angle stop valve (Aka angle pattern globe valve) while there is flow. As soon as the flow stops, then the pressure will equalise throughout the system. I would suggest using a PRV or pressure reducing valve. This will control water pressure under most all conditions. Water column pressure is the measure of pressure exerted by a vertical column of water in a particular area. It is commonly used in hydrology and oceanography to describe the pressure at a given depth in a body of water. This pressure increases with depth due to the weight of the water above pushing down.
